    Northisle Copper and Gold Inc. (TSXV:NCX)  is pleased to report the completion of a 1,846 metre diamond drilling program on its wholly owned North Island Copper-Gold project on Vancouver Island, British Columbia.
    The program consisted of six holes, five targeting three exploration targets and one directed at collecting a metallurgical sample for future testing.
    Core samples from this year’s drill program have been sent to BVL Minerals’ laboratory in Vancouver. Results will be announced once analyses from all holes have been received and compiled.
    The exploration drilling focused primarily on three target areas:

    1. The southeastern extension of the Hushamu deposit outside of the current resource boundary.
    2. A 300 metre diameter area within the current Hushamu resource where historical widely-spaced vertical drill holes indicated very low-grade or no mineralization was present.
    3. A test for deeply buried porphyry copper and gold mineralization to the south of the Red Dog Deposit.

    The hole testing the southeastern extension intersected porphyry-type alteration and sulphide mineralization over its entire length of 225 metres.  In addition, the 3 angled holes drilled within the 300 metre diameter zone previously classified as “barren” confirmed that the previous historical holes had been drilled down relatively narrow post mineralization dykes.
    The single hole testing the deep porphyry target at the Red Dog Deposit encountered high-level porphyry copper alteration from bedrock to 290 metres where the hole was lost due to caving material from a fault higher in the hole.
    The Company also reports that detailed engineering studies are nearing completion and the Preliminary Economic Assessment (PEA) on the combined the Hushamu and Red Dog deposits and itis anticipated that the PEA will be completed by the end of August.

    About Northisle

    The North Island Copper-Gold Project is situated approximately 15-40 kilometres southwest of Port Hardy, BC near the formerly producing Island Copper Deposit on the north end of Vancouver Island. The deposit contains the Hushamu and Red Dog deposits and five other partially explored copper-gold porphyry occurrences. The project is 100% owned by Northisle.
    The Hushamu Resource
    The Company has a current resource estimate of the Hushamu Deposit which has been filed on SEDAR.

    The Red Dog Resource
    The Red Dog Resource is located 8km northwest of the Hushamu Deposit and hosts a NI 43-101 Indicated Resource of 23.6 million tonnes grading 0.32% copper, 0.46gpt gold and 0.007% molybdenum.
